SRMS INSTITUTE OF MEDICAL SCIENCES HOSTS ‘IAS ONE BAREILLY’: NATIONAL EXPERTS SHOWCASE LATEST ADVANCES IN KNEE ARTHROSCOPY

The Department of Orthopedics at SRMS Institute of Medical Sciences (IMS), Bareilly, brought together leading orthopedic minds from across India at the National-Level Advanced Knee Arthroscopy Course ‘IAS ONE Bareilly’. Held under the aegis of the Indian Arthroscopy Society (IAS) & powered by Biotek, the event spotlighted groundbreaking innovations in knee ligament assessment, surgical techniques & rehabilitation.

The prestigious course was inaugurated by Shri Dev Murti, Chairman, SRMS Trust, and Guest of Honor Dr Rajeev Raman, IAS ONE Convener from Kolkata, alongside Dr MS Butola (Principal, IMS), Dr Vinod Pagrani (Orthopedic Surgeon, Khushlok Hospital) & Organizing Secretary Dr Apser Khan (Professor, Orthopedics, IMS).

In his welcome address, Organizing Chairman, Professor Dr Sanjay Gupta, HOD, Orthopedics Department, set the stage for an intensive learning experience. The academic sessions began with Dr Neeraj Prajapati (IMS) discussing radiological tools in diagnosing ligament injuries such as ACL, PCL, PLC, and collateral tears. Dr Rohil Mehta (Director & Consultant at City Hospital, Lucknow) elaborated on graft selection, fixation techniques & rehabilitation protocols, followed by Dr Ashish Kumar Srivastava’s talk on managing complications in ACL reconstruction.

Highlighting advanced surgical techniques, Dr Rajeev Raman presented insights on LET, ALL & High Tibial Osteotomy (HTO), along with complex procedures like PLC & Root Repairs. National faculty members Dr Vineet Jain & Dr Dhananjay Shabat enriched the sessions with live surgical videos and detailed presentations on malalignment correction, PCL avulsion repair & ramp lesion management.

Further sessions by experts Dr Sameer R. Verma & Dr Puneet Agarwal delved into specialized knee repair strategies. The knowledge-sharing conference concluded with a high-level panel discussion on multiligamentous knee injuries, followed by a hands-on meniscus repair workshop.
